I have always though that (and do) when you design a website, you use tables to create the layout. I use dreamweaver, and when i want to create a site i just you the insert table feature, and add the appropriate number of cells and columns.
Yeasterday I was download some on a
web design templates and came across a post that said something about know one using tables anymore, and the latest sites are all
xhtml (instead of
html), and the layouts are designed using
css. I had always thought
css was just used for the colour, font, mouse over effect, etc on a hyperlink (this is what i have used it for in the past).